Why These Are the Top Ford Repair Auto Repair Shops in Orma

The Ford repair market for Orma, WV, and the broader rural region of Calhoun and nearby counties is characterized by a reliance on local, independent garages rather than dedicated Ford specialists. There are no Ford-specific specialty shops located directly within Orma. The market is not highly competitive in a traditional sense, but the few reputable providers are in high demand due to the rural population's dependence on trucks and SUVs, predominantly from Ford. Typical pricing is moderate, generally lower than in major metropolitan areas but commensurate with the level of expertise required. For complex issues (e.g., Power Stroke diesel repair, advanced transmission work), residents often travel to dealerships in larger hubs like Elkview or Charleston. The overall quality of general repair is good, but finding specific expertise for advanced Ford systems like EcoBoost turbos or SelectShift transmissions requires seeking out the most highly-recommended shops in the wider region.

What are the most common Ford repair issues for vehicles in the Orma, WV area?

Given the hilly terrain and seasonal weather, common issues include brake wear, suspension components like ball joints and shocks, and 4WD system maintenance for F-Series trucks and SUVs. Older Ford models in the area also frequently need attention for rust prevention due to road salt in winter.

How can I find a reliable and trustworthy Ford repair shop near Orma?

For specialized Ford service, residents often look to established shops in nearby towns like Spencer or Grantsville, as Orma itself is very small. Check for shops with certified technicians, strong local word-of-mouth reputations, and those that use quality Motorcraft or OEM parts for repairs.

Are repair costs for Fords higher in rural Orma compared to bigger cities?

Labor rates in rural Calhoun County can be slightly lower than in metro areas, but parts availability may cause delays or increased costs for specific components, requiring sourcing from larger distributors. Always get a detailed written estimate upfront for any major repair.

When should I seek service for my Ford truck used on local backroads and farms?

Seek immediate service for unusual noises, pulling, or vibration, especially after navigating rough, unpaved roads common in the area. Adhere strictly to severe service schedule maintenance for fluid changes and inspections due to dusty, muddy, and steep driving conditions.

What local factors should I consider for Ford maintenance in Orma?

Prioritize undercarriage washes and fluid checks to combat winter corrosion from road salt. Given the limited local options, plan ahead for scheduled maintenance and build a relationship with a shop that can provide loaner tools or towing recommendations for roadside breakdowns in remote areas.
